Why Arabica Beans are the Best Choice

Arabica beans are considered to be of higher quality than Robusta beans due to their more delicate and nuanced flavor profile. They have a higher acidity level, which gives them a brighter and more complex taste. Arabica beans are also more expensive than Robusta beans, but the difference in flavor is well worth the extra cost.

Step 1: Brew Your Coffee

Start by brewing a cup of coffee using your preferred method. You can use a drip coffee maker, French press, or even a pour-over. The key is to use freshly roasted and ground coffee beans to get the best flavor.

Tips for Brewing the Perfect Cup of Coffee

  • Use fresh and cold water to prevent any off-flavors or odors.
  • Use the right amount of coffee for your brewing method. A general rule of thumb is to use 1 tablespoon of coffee for every 6 ounces of water.
  • Experiment with different brewing times to find the perfect balance of flavor and strength.
